More on the blight
Well it appears this Late Blight is very widespread and is taking out farmers' crops as well. The green tomatoes that had no spots, that I took home, are now getting brown spots on them and they are not turning red at all. Some research has shown that this year's blight has come from varieties sold at Home Depot, Walmart, etc. I bought my tomato plants from Home Depot. Next year I am going to raise my plants from seeds.
